Otis Elevator Company is the world`s largest manufacturer and maintainer of people-moving products, including elevators, escalators and moving walkways. Headquartered in Farmington, Connecticut, USA, Otis employs more than 60,000 people, offers products and services in more than 200 countries and territories and maintains more than 1.35 million lifts and escalators worldwide.
